2025 Compare Cities Politics & Voting:
Mankato, MN vs Golden, CO
Change Cities
Highlights
- Registered voters in Golden are 13.8% more likely to be registered as Democrats than registered voters in Mankato.
- Registered voters in Mankato, are 11.8% less likely to be registered as Democrats, than in the rest of the United States.
